
















Product Introduction
The HM-SDX is a handheld water toxicity detection instrument designed for rapid field screening of water quality threats using the luminescent bacteria bioluminescence inhibition method. When toxic substances contact luminescent bacteria (Vibrio fischeri, Photobacterium phosphoreum, Vibrio qinghaiensis), the bacterial light output decreases proportionally to toxicity concentration — the HM-SDX quantifies this inhibition to provide immediate qualitative toxicity assessment.
Measuring just 188×77×37mm, the HM-SDX brings laboratory-grade toxicity screening to field environments including water treatment plant patrols, emergency response situations, aquaculture monitoring, and environmental inspection operations. The 3500mAh rechargeable battery supports over 4 hours of continuous measurements without recharging.
The instrument offers three measurement modes in a single device: qualitative toxicity screening (luminescent bacteria inhibition), ATP bacteria counting (microbial contamination assessment), and combined screening mode. This multi-mode approach enables comprehensive water quality characterization from a single compact instrument, eliminating the need to carry separate devices for different analytical purposes.

Functional Performance
Three-in-one measurement capability: qualitative toxicity + ATP bacteria count + combined screening in a single handheld device
15-minute rapid qualitative toxicity result using luminescent bacteria bioluminescence inhibition method per GB/T15441-1995
15-second ATP detection for real-time microbial contamination assessment
Pluggable removable washable test tubes reduce per-test consumable costs and eliminate cross-contamination risk
3.5-inch color touchscreen with intuitive graphical interface for clear result presentation in field conditions
Android intelligent operating system with user-friendly navigation and on-screen operation guidance
Wi-Fi, mobile hotspot, and Bluetooth connectivity for real-time data transmission to cloud monitoring platforms
SiPM (silicon photomultiplier) detector delivers enhanced sensitivity across 300–1100nm spectral range
Over 80,000 records storage capacity with USB data export in Excel format
Built-in 3500mAh lithium battery providing over 4 hours continuous operation and 10+ hours standby
ATP mode with configurable upper and lower threshold values for streamlined pass/fail determination
Main Parameters
| Parameter | Specification |
|---|---|
| Measurement Modes | Fast mode, Standard mode, ATP mode |
| Detector | Silicon photomultiplier (SiPM) |
| Spectral Range | 300–1100nm |
| Measurement Range | 0–999,999 RLU |
| ATP Sensitivity | 10⁻¹⁵ ~ 10⁻¹⁸ mol |
| Bacteria Strains | Photobacterium phosphoreum, Vibrio fischeri, Vibrio qinghaiensis |
| Method Standard | GB/T15441-1995 & ISO 11348-3 |
Technical Parameters
| Parameter | Specification |
|---|---|
| Inhibition Rate Range | -100% ~ 100% |
| Clear Water Luminescence Inhibition Rate | ≤ ±5% |
| ATP Detection Limit | 9.4×10⁻¹⁵ mol ATP, RLU ≤ 2 |
| ATP Repeatability | ≤ 2.3% RSD at ~100 RLU (n=10) |
| ATP Linear Error | ≥ -3.6% at ~100 RLU |
| Toxicity Test Accuracy | Relative deviation < 6% (3 replicates) |
| Sensitivity | Equivalent or superior to 96-hour fish acute toxicity test |
| Toxicity Test Time | Within 15 minutes after sample preparation |
| ATP Test Time | 15 seconds after sample preparation |
| Display Results | Inhibition rate (%), RLU, toxicity warning (low/toxic/heavy/high/highly toxic) |
| Background Noise | ≤ 6 RLU (n=10) |
| Data Storage | 80,000+ records |
| Communication | Wi-Fi, Mobile hotspot, USB, Bluetooth |
| Battery | 3500mAh lithium battery |
| Continuous Working Time | > 4 hours |
| Charging Voltage | 220V / 5V |
| Operating Temperature | +5 ~ +45°C |
| Storage Temperature | -10 ~ +50°C |
| Relative Humidity | 30–95% (25°C) |
| Instrument Dimensions | 188mm × 77mm × 37mm |
| Packaging Dimensions | 550mm × 245mm × 375mm |
| Package Weight | 6kg |
